Update via update manager from 11.10 to 12.04 went wrong

 

I tried to update to 12.04 on a netbook (Samsung NP-150) but that
update went badly wrong.

First a small issue: During installation i was asked if >Desktop<
should be renamed to the standard language (German) term
(>Arbeitsfläche<), the files there would not be touched. Si i said
yes, but unfortunately, the files are gone! :-(

The main issue is: lubuntu-core, lubuntu-default-settings,
lubuntu-desktop are not configured because of unresolved dependencies
(lightdm-gtk-greeter is not configured). I tried to do sudo
dpkg-reconfigure lightdm, no effect. Then i purged all lightdm and
tried to re-install it. I can't. Strangely internet is not working
(wicd does not recognize a router - that might be due to a conflict
with network-manager which came with the update; network-manager
connects to the router but does not connect to the internet. BUT: the
router is fine - with this other computer i'm writing on in this
moment and which is connected to the same router i get into the
internet!).

Actually, i still have lxdm as display-manager but so far i can only
login to LXDE not to lubuntu. May be there is missing some piece, or
there is some wrong setup, i've no idea at this point.
